The stereo systems come in three broad types, Hi-Fi, Mid-Fi and Low-fi. The Hi fi is a kind of a mini system that comes with a wattage of 40-100 per channel and a speaker of good quality. the price range is between 400-2000$, but all that depends on the features therein. The Mid-fi system are good to use for children's rooms as secondary systems. They are more economical because they range between 200-400$

The Low-Fi are more of a boom box as far as sound quality is concerned. They re not so bad though because you can still play both tapes and CDs in them. Other additional features are amplifier, speakers, AM/FM tune, sub woofer and tape deck. Special features are bass boost circuitry, mega CD changer, electronic equalization or graphic equalizer, spacial sound enhancement that gives you great circuitry, video inputs and mini disc recorders.
